如何理解ASPICE 3.1在汽车软件开发中的重要性及其对质量管控的影响?
时间: 2024-11-30 22:26:12 浏览: 37
ASPICE 3.1作为一个汽车行业特定的软件过程评估和参考模型,其重要性主要体现在为汽车软件开发提供了标准化的质量管控框架。它不仅帮助组织理解、评估和改进软件开发过程,还确保了软件产品满足行业内的严格要求和标准。ASPICE模型特别强调过程管理,要求企业在软件开发生命周期中实施明确的过程控制和持续改进。通过评估不同的过程域,如项目管理、需求管理、设计、实现、验证、确认、配置管理、质量和过程管理,企业可以系统地识别关键的质量控制点,及时发现并解决问题,从而提高软件产品的整体质量,降低研发风险。
参考资源链接:[ASPICE 3.1:汽车行业软件开发能力评估模型](https://wenku.csdn.net/doc/247scxoy6v?spm=1055.2569.3001.10343)
ASPICE 3.1对质量管控的影响是多方面的。首先,它要求企业采用一种结构化的方法来管理软件开发项目,包括明确的项目目标、资源分配和进度跟踪。其次,通过细致的需求管理,确保软件功能准确反映用户需求。此外,通过有效的设计和实现过程,保证软件架构和代码的质量。而验证和确认过程则确保软件功能和性能达到预定标准。配置管理维护了开发过程的可追溯性,而质量管理则确保了整个开发过程中的质量一致性。
结合《ASPICE 3.1:汽车行业软件开发能力评估模型》这一资料,读者可以更深入地理解ASPICE模型的各个过程域的具体要求,以及如何运用这一模型来提升软件开发的质量和效率。该资料详细介绍了ASPICE 3.1的新特点、过程域、评估标准和最佳实践,为读者提供了全面的理论知识和实用的指导。通过学习这本资料,软件开发人员和项目经理能够更好地应对汽车行业对高质量车载软件的需求,并且在国际汽车供应链中提升竞争力。
参考资源链接:[ASPICE 3.1:汽车行业软件开发能力评估模型](https://wenku.csdn.net/doc/247scxoy6v?spm=1055.2569.3001.10343)
阅读全文